Abstract EN

Letting (X,d) be a metric space, f:X→X a continuous map, and (ℱ(X),D) the space of nonempty fuzzy compact subsets of X with the Hausdorff metric, one may study the dynamical properties of the Zadeh's extension f̂:ℱ(X)→ℱ(X):u↦f̂u.

In this paper, we present, as a response to the question proposed by Román-Flores and Chalco-Cano 2008, some chaotic relations between f and f̂.

More specifically, we study the transitivity, weakly mixing, periodic density in system (X,f), and its connections with the same ones in its fuzzified system.
